Output d24afca41b11e7d33b0df6cfc9c08677577811d7185f0c3620b2cdcbcccf5714:0

value
74065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42857bf4a62c81a400f65fbb4c423873ed8b04d4 OP_EQUAL
address
37kkRrDxuRtZ7HCcA5iy3bqgmT2z1XcYcN
transaction
d24afca41b11e7d33b0df6cfc9c08677577811d7185f0c3620b2cdcbcccf5714
spent
true